HIL 8390 is a 2010 Alfa Romeo GT in Red with a 1,910c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2010 Alfa Romeo GT models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.6% with a typical mileage of 73,186 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Alfa Romeo GT f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 5,784 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HIL 8390,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Alfa Romeo GT typ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 16 years old, this Alfa Romeo GT is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
